[Letter from Truett Latimer to Mrs. J. H. Spratt, July 14, 1961]

Description: Letter from Truett Latimer to Mrs. J. H. Spratt discussing Latimer's record of of voting for taxes on alcohol. Latimer writes that the governor's proposals would only raise a quarter of the funds necessary to pay for pensions, teachers' salaries, and other state functions, and that he wants people to understand exactly what the governor's tax bill is.

[Letter from Truett Latimer to Frank Schatz, July 14, 1961]

Description: Letter from Truett Latimer to Frank Schatz discussing the tax problems in Texas. He disagrees with Mr. Schatz's suggestion of a tax on soft drinks and suggests it would be better to increase the tax on beer. He also lets him know that he voted for a bill akin to a retail sales tax that would exclude basic necessities like food and drugs.
